Obverse description Uncrowned effigy of King Charles III facing left, rendered in high relief with finely detailed hair and naturalistic facial features, occupying the central field. The engraver's initials JC appear below the truncation. The surrounding legend reads CHARLES III · NIUE · at left and TWELVE DOLLARS at right, with · 5oz Ag 999 · arching across the upper field and · 2025 · positioned along the lower rim, all in bold upright Latin capitals. The antiqued finish imparts a deep patina that enhances the sculptural modeling of the portrait.

Reverse description A draped female figure personifying Aquarius is depicted in high relief at center, facing the viewer with a solemn, serene expression and long flowing hair adorned with a diadem headband. She cradles a large ornate urn or water-bearer's vessel in her arms, from which water cascades downward, rendered with fluid sculptural precision. Her garment is a classical drape fastened at one shoulder, leaving the other bare, with decorative bracelet details at the wrist. The background is engraved with swirling, wave-like arabesques evoking the element of water. The legend AQUARIUS appears incuse in the left field, and the entire design is enhanced by an antiqued silver finish that accentuates the deep relief and fine surface engraving.
